Total songs = 1240
Rock songs = 40%
Songs that are not rock = 100 - 40 = 60%
It would be: 1240 * 60% = 1240 * 0.60 = 744
In short, Your Answer would be 744

Answer:
- Josh's book lands first
- Ben's lands about 0.648 seconds later
Step-by-step explanation:
Using the given equation for v=60 and s=40, the height of Ben's book is ...
h(t) = -16t² +60t +40
We want to find t when h(t) = 0, so we're looking for the solution to ....
0 = -16t² +60t +40
Using the quadratic formula, we find the positive value of t to be ...
t = (-60 -√(60² -4(-16)(40)))/(2(-16)) = (15 +√385)/8 ≈ 4.3277
__
Similarly, the height of Josh's book is ...
0 = -16t² +48t +40
t = (-48 -√(48² -4(-16)(40)))/(2(-16)) = (12 +√304)/8 ≈ 3.6794
__
The time before Josh's book lands is shorter by ...
4.3277 -3.6794 ≈ 0.6482 . . . . . seconds
Josh's book reaches the ground first, by about 0.648 seconds.
Answer:
<u>$4800</u>
Step-by-step explanation:
The expected net income is the probability when rains multiplied by net income (profit) summed with the probability of not raining with that days net income multiplied.
First, Chance of rain = 12% = 12/100 = 0.12
Profit/Loss = Income - Cost
Income is 5000
Cost = 9000
So,
Loss = 5000 - 9000 = 4000
Or, Net Income (profit) = - 4000
Now, Change of not raining = 100 - 12 = 88% = 88/100 = 0.88
Profit = Income - Cost
Income = 15,000
Cost = 9000
Net Income (profit) = 15000 - 9000 = 6000
So, we can write the expected net income as:
<u>Expected NI </u>= (0.12)(-4000) + (0.88)(6000) = <u>$4800</u>
